PE-Labeled Human EGF R Protein, His Tag (EGR-HP2H7) is produced via conjugation of PE to Human EGF R Protein, His Tag with a new generation site-specific technology under Star Staining labeling platform. Human EGF R Protein, His Tag is expressed from human 293 cells (HEK293). It contains AA Leu 25 - Ser 645 (Accession # P00533-1).
Predicted N-terminus: Leu 25
Molecular Characterization
This protein carries a polyhistidine tag at the C-terminus.

Evaluation of CAR expression
FACS Analysis of Anti-EGF R CAR Expression

5e5 of anti-EGFR CAR-293 cells were stained with 100 μL of 1:50 dilution (2 μL stock solution in 100 μL FACS buffer) of PE-Labeled Human EGF R Protein, His Tag (Cat. No. EGR-HP2H7) and negative control protein respectively (Fig. C and B), and non-transfected 293 cells were used as a control (Fig. A). PE signal was used to evaluate the binding activity (QC tested).
ProtocolFACS Analysis of Non-specific binding to PBMCs

5e5 of PBMCs were stained with PE-Labeled Human EGF R Protein, His Tag (Cat. No. EGR-HP2H7) and anti-CD3 antibody, washed and then analyzed with FACS. FITC signal was used to evaluate the expression of CD3+ T cells in PBMCs, and PE signal was used to evaluate the non-specific binding activity to PBMCs (QC tested).
